About The Position

The Account Services Analyst serves as a strategic operational partner responsible for managing complex client and business issues that require advanced analysis, cross-functional coordination, and end-to-end ownership. This role acts as the primary point of accountability for resolving issues affecting client operations, service delivery, regulatory requirements, and business outcomes. The Account Services Analyst is responsible for leading multifaceted issues through investigation, stakeholder engagement, root cause analysis, and implementation of sustainable solutions. The role requires independent decision-making, critical thinking, strong business acumen, and the ability to influence teams across the organization to achieve positive client outcomes. This role is primarily operational and service-focused, supporting account performance, issue resolution, and Plan execution behind the scenes, with targeted client and Aetna interaction as needed.

Responsibilities

  • Manage assigned account activities, ensuring efficient execution of client deliverables and service expectations.
  • Analyze reporting data to validate alignment with client intent and plan setup, identifying trends and discrepancies.
  • Resolve client and member-level issues by coordinating with internal teams and applying strategic problem-solving.
  • Consult with internal partners to develop tailored solutions that meet client needs and maintain CMS compliance for Medicare accounts.
  • Monitor account performance and contribute to centralized support initiatives that enhance operational efficiency.
  • Communicate clearly and professionally with clients and internal departments to ensure transparency and alignment.
